A reputable engineering firm in Highweek is seeking a Quality Control Technician to join their fabrication workshop team. The role involves inspecting steelwork to ensure compliance with engineering standards, checking material quality, and recording inspection results.

Candidates should possess essential knowledge of steelwork and fabrication, strong maths and technical skills, along with a keen attention to detail and good communication abilities. Competitive pay based on experience is offered.
